A hierarchical scale is a technique in art primarily in sculpture and painting whereby artists scale down or scale up the figures in an artwork to signify their relative importance. They depict the use of unrealistic proportions or unnatural scales to depict the size or shape to emphasize the importance of the figure in the artwork.

Hierarchical proportion is a technique used in art mostly in sculpture and painting in which the artist uses unnatural proportion or scale to depict the relative importance of the figures in the artwork. In laymans terms The bigger it is the more important. This meant gods or the pharaoh were usually bigger than other figures followed by figures of high officials or the tomb owner. -Hierarchical scale refers to the deliberate use of relative size in a work of art in order to communicate differences in importance -Almost always larger means more important and smaller means less important Jan van Eyck Madonna in a Church -Uses hierarchical scale to communicate spiritual importance.
